Assessing the role of Syntaxin18 in controlling c-myc mRNA expression and growth in human breast cancer cells.

Abstract
Messenger RNA stability is critical in the control of gene expression. Enzymes capable of cleaving RNA, termed ribonucleases, are gaining appreciation for their role in regulating gene expression. Our lab has discovered a novel protein which has been shown to cleave c-myc mRNA within the coding region determinant (CRD). This protein was tentatively identified as Syntaxin18, a known t-SNARE protein. Recombinant Syntaxin18 has been shown to possess endoribonucleolytic activity against c-myc mRNA in vitro. In order to determine whether Syntaxin18 functions as an endoribonucleae in cells, the effect of altering its expression on the proliferation, levels and stability of c-myc mRNA was examined. The expression of Syntaxin18 in various cell lines and tissues were also compared. Through Western analysis, it was discovered that the expression of Syntaxin18 was similar in all immortalized cancer cell lines examined. However, higher Syntaxin18 expression was observed in cancerous breast tissue when compared to the normal breast tissue. MTT assays revealed that modulation of Syntaxin18 was able to affect the proliferation of MCF-7 cells, and this effect was observed only upon incubation with 17-β-estradiol and insulin. Finally, ribonuclease protection assay analysis showed that modulation of Syntaxin18 may have an effect on the steady-state levels of c-myc and β-actin mRNAs; however, down-regulation of Syntaxin18 did not impact the stability of the c-myc transcript. Based on results obtained from this study, it remains unclear whether Syntaxin18 can function as an endoribonuclease in MCF-7 cells. |
